c语言大小写互换函数 c语言大小写互换函数怎么表示
c语言小写字母转大写字母?
1、讲n=strlen(s)放到函数里面,就可以了。
2、在C语言中,每一个常用字符都对应着一个ASCII值,大写字母A~Z对应的ASCII为65~90,小写字母a~z对应的ASCII值为97~122。大写字母与小写字母的ASCII值相差32,故可以通过这一点实现大写字母与小写字母的转换。
3、这个差值是十进制的32。在不记得这个差值的情况下,可以用a-A来表示。
4、在C语言中,小写字母转换为大写字母的方法是将小写字母的ASCII码值减去32(例:A=a-32);大写字母转换为小写字母的的方法是将大写字母的ASCII码值加上32(例:a=A+32)即可。
c语言编程:将小写字母转换为大写字母并输出。急求谢了。
1、include stdio.h void main(){ char ch;printf(请输入一个小写字母:\n);scanf(%c,& ch);printf(其大写字符是:%c\n,ch-32);} 加入其他错误主要是可能的输入不是小写字母的判断。
2、首先建立一个工程和.c文件。接下来开始输入头文件。然后输入主函数。定义一个字符型的变量。然后输入scanf,表示输出。输入printf函数,输出该小写字母的ASCII码及其大写字母。编译检查。
3、char();③ b=a—32;④ 打印输出。
4、else if((c=a)& & (c=z)) c-=32;//否则判断是否为小写字母,是则转换为大写字母。else //否则,该字符不是字母,则输出“该字符不是字母”并结束程序。
5、你的程序里面获取循环的位置不对,也就是获取的字符串长度的n应该放在函数里面。讲n=strlen(s)放到函数里面,就可以了。
6、比如,大写字母A的ASSCII值是65,那么zhi小写a就是65+32=97。依次类推d其他字母。
C语言大小写字母转换
1、小写的字母ASCII码为 97(a)到 122(z),转换成大写字母则ASCII减32,变成从65(A)到90(Z)每个字母对应一个ascii码,查ascii码表就可以一目了然。
2、define DAXIE(x) (x=A & & x=Z) //判断是大写字符。define XIAOXIE(x) (x=a & & x=z) //判断是小写字符。
3、void main(){ char c;scanf(%c,& c); //输入一个字母。if ((c=A)& & (c=Z)) c+=32;//判断是否为大写字母,是则转换为小写字母。
4、字母大小写转换c语言:在C语言中,小写字母转换为大写字母的方法是将小写字母的ASCII码值减去32(例:A=a-32);大写字母转换为小写字母的的方法是将大写字母的ASCII码值加上32(例:a=A+32)即可。
5、C语言中,字符的存储占用一个字节,且都是使用其对应的ASCII码值来存储的。
声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!
若转载请注明出处: c语言大小写互换函数 c语言大小写互换函数怎么表示
本文地址: https://pptw.com/jishu/69376.html
